千葉県の独特な山容。地獄のぞきの断崖と大仏が見どころ。
鋸山は千葉県房総半島にある標高329mの山で、何世紀にもわたる石切りによってできた鋸歯状の稜線が名前の由来です。日本寺には日本最大級の磨崖仏があり、スリル満点の地獄のぞきの展望台があります。標高は低いものの、露出した崖のトレイルと東京湾のパノラマビューが印象的です。

見どころ
地獄のぞきの断崖展望台; 高さ31mの磨崖大仏; 歴史的な石切り場跡; 東京湾と富士山のパノラマビュー; 1553体の石造羅漢像
アクセス
東京からJR内房線で浜金谷駅まで約2時間。ロープウェイ乗り場は駅から徒歩すぐ。車の場合は館山自動車道を利用。神奈川県久里浜から金谷港への東京湾フェリーも利用可能。
注意事項・安全情報
Steep stone staircases can be very slippery when wet. The Jigoku Nozoki overlook has railings but requires caution. Some sections have significant drop-offs. Not recommended in heavy rain or strong winds.
